    Started it up to move it: got a CEL finally:
    cylinder 4 misfire.
    Ok bad sparkplug: changed sparkplug: it looked ok but changed anyways:
    New CEL, : multiple/random cylinder misfire.
    Moved cylinder 4 coil pack to cylinder 3: same code.
    I'm done. Sending to shop.
